Some Preparation For You To Hold A Wedding In Spring

You must be very happy but also a little nervous while planning your wedding. In general, if you have decided to marry your beloved man, then the first thing you need to consider is the date of your wedding. In terms of the season, spring and autumn are the most popular wedding season for couples. As we all know, spring time is the beginning of a new year; it symbolizes renewal and rebirth. So, if you want to hold your wedding in spring, then you can read this article to make it clear how to prepare a wedding.

The first thing is to decide the date and time of the wedding ceremony. Then you can book the venue and print wedding invitations as soon as possible. You can choose any wedding location as you like. If you want a formal wedding ceremony, you can choose church as the venue. But if you are into romantic setting, then garden is your best choice. For wedding invitation, just remember that the color of your invitation card should be the same as the theme color of your wedding. You can also use some beautiful ribbons or bows to decorate the invitation cards. That can make them and artistic and attractive. Read the rest of this entry »

Wrought Iron Wedding Centerpieces And Other Centerpiece Ideas

Wedding centerpieces can come in all shapes, colors, and sizes. Some people prefer flowers; others beautifully wrapped favors; and others wrought iron wedding centerpieces. There really are no hard and fast rules governing wedding centerpieces. This is why couples enjoy selecting the perfect centerpiece to reflect their personalities and their union to one another.

Flower centerpieces are a popular selection. Choose a delicate glass vase, a variety of flowers that match your wedding colors, and some colorful glass beads. River-washed rocks or granite fragments can also provide a beautiful bedding for your floral selection. Make sure you select the correct size of vase for your tables so that they are neither dwarfed by the table nor overwhelming.

Wrought iron wedding centerpieces are also a classic choice. The genteel, classic look of wrought iron will complement the decor of any traditional wedding. Favorites include candelabras or wrought iron vases and urns. Wrought iron is the perfect choice to project a feeling of seriousness and classic beauty. White or champagne-colored candles are a great choice with wrought iron – brightly colored candles can detract from the beauty of the iron.

Other wedding ideas include floating flower centerpieces. These centerpieces are clear glass bowls filled with water. Blossoms, petals, and candles can be carefully placed to float on top of the water. Guests will enjoy watching the beautiful and ever-changing look of these unusual centerpieces. As an added bonus, floating candles cast shimmering, flickering light into the room, creating an atmosphere of intimacy and warmth.

Winter Wedding Centerpieces

One of the most import aspects for any winter wedding are the winter wedding centerpieces. They often make or break the theme and in essence are central to the overall mood of your wedding reception. Before deciding on the specifics of the centerpieces however, you might want to first decide on the atmosphere you wish to create. You could have a traditional white winter wedding with string lights, the warm glow of candles, with snow all around or perhaps incorporate the colors red and white if your wedding day is close to Christmas. Perhaps even something a little more rustic displaying small fir trees indoors along with your beautiful winter wedding centerpieces that help bring the outdoors in.

Some examples of materials you can use for your wedding centerpieces include mirrors, candles, crystal snowflakes, frosted glass vases, and votives which all can be used to set a wonderful winter wedding mood. You could also use fake snow or ice, glitter confetti, sleds, reindeer, decorative mittens or even ice skates.

Flowers such as winterberry gaultheria, amaryllis, double white hellebores, boxwood stems, holly branches, fir branches, and of course the traditional poinsettias or mistletoe can all be used to further enhance the mood at your wedding reception. Any of the flowers or branches mentioned can be paired with a variety of red roses or you could simply use white roses to create classic winter wedding centerpieces.
